Stoke take on Brentford in a big game for both sides – but arguably a bigger game for Leeds United fans.

Advertisement

A win for Brentford would secure at least third place for them in the Championship season, and would temporarily put them into the automatic promotion places ahead of West Brom.

A draw for Stoke would virtually guarantee their survival at the wrong end of the table.

Anything less than a Brentford victory would secure promotion for Leeds after 16 years away from the Premier League without them having to kick a ball.

Stoke v Brentford team news

Stoke: Joe Allen and Jack Butland miss out, Tyrese Campbell could return to the team.

Brentford: Nikolaos Karelis and Shandon Baptiste are likely to be sidelined though Josh Dasilva is expected to start.

Our prediction: Stoke v Brentford

Brentford know what is at stake here, and forgetting the Leeds scenario, they have their own sights set on the Premier League.

The Bees have plenty of attacking muscle and will hope top scorer Ollie Watkins can dig deep once again.

They sit top of the Championship form table with six wins out of six, while West Brom have only won three in that time. A victory over Stoke would ramp the pressure up massively on the Baggies.
